    i found water in the oil and it turns out that it was a bad intake gasket at the water jacket . the more i work on this car the more that i find wrong . the wireing is a nightmare with no fuse box :eek: , the floor is " ALL" wood , the rear of the shifter isn't mounted to the tranny as it should be , the fuel line is just hanging under the car and isn't attatched to the frame , and the fuel tank is just lying in the trunk unsecured :eek: . i can't believe that the car was actually driven this way .

    the rear of the frame has been Z'd , but for some reason they welded some metal closing off the Z that causes the car to bottom out on the rear end .
